The history of mathematics is a rich tapestry that spans across cultures and centuries, influencing various aspects of human development. Here's a concise overview:

1. **Ancient Mesopotamia (3000 BCE - 600 BCE):** The earliest roots of mathematics can be traced to Mesopotamia, where the Babylonians developed a system of counting and early forms of geometry for practical purposes like land surveying.

2. **Ancient Egypt (3000 BCE - 600 BCE):** Ancient Egyptians used mathematics for practical applications such as architecture and agriculture. They had a well-developed understanding of geometry, crucial for construction projects like the pyramids.

3. **Ancient Greece (600 BCE - 300 BCE):** Greek mathematicians, including Pythagoras, Euclid, and Archimedes, made significant contributions. Pythagoras' theorem, Euclidean geometry, and the method of exhaustion developed by Archimedes are enduring components of mathematical knowledge.

4. **Ancient India (600 BCE - 600 CE):** Indian mathematicians made strides in number theory, trigonometry, and algebra. Aryabhata, Brahmagupta, and Bhaskara II were notable contributors.

5. **Islamic Golden Age (8th - 14th centuries):** During this period, Islamic scholars preserved and expanded upon ancient Greek and Indian mathematical knowledge. Al-Khwarizmi's work laid the foundation for algebra, and advancements were made in trigonometry and geometry.

6. **Renaissance and the Scientific Revolution (14th - 17th centuries):** European mathematicians like Leonardo Fibonacci, Nicolaus Copernicus, and Johannes Kepler contributed to the development of mathematical ideas, laying the groundwork for the scientific method.

7. **17th to 19th Centuries:** The era saw the rise of calculus, pioneered independently by Isaac Newton and Gottfried Wilhelm Leibniz. Euler's contributions to graph theory and number theory were noteworthy. Meanwhile, the development of probability theory took place.

8. **19th to Early 20th Centuries:** The foundations of modern mathematics were established with the formalization of set theory by Georg Cantor. Non-Euclidean geometries emerged, challenging traditional views. David Hilbert proposed a list of unsolved mathematical problems, guiding research for decades.

9. **20th Century:** The century witnessed profound developments in various branches, including abstract algebra, topology, and mathematical logic. Computers played an increasingly vital role in mathematical research. The Four Color Theorem was proven, and Andrew Wiles solved Fermat's Last Theorem in 1994.

10. **Contemporary Era:** Mathematics continues to evolve with contributions to fields like cryptography, chaos theory, and mathematical biology. The exploration of new mathematical structures and the interplay with other disciplines remains a vibrant area of research.

The history of mathematics reflects a continual quest for understanding patterns, structures, and relationships, shaping the way we comprehend the world around us.

11. **Development of Modern Logic (late 19th - 20th centuries):** Logicians such as Bertrand Russell and Alfred North Whitehead worked on the ambitious project of Principia Mathematica, attempting to establish a logical foundation for all of mathematics. Kurt Gödel's incompleteness theorems, published in the 1930s, had a profound impact on understanding the limitations of formal systems.

12. **Computational Mathematics (20th century onwards):** The advent of computers revolutionized mathematical research and applications. Fields like numerical analysis and computational mathematics gained prominence, allowing mathematicians to tackle complex problems with computational methods.

13. **Fractals and Chaos Theory (late 20th century):** Benoît Mandelbrot's work on fractal geometry introduced a new way of understanding irregular shapes and patterns in nature. Chaos theory, pioneered by Edward Lorenz, explored deterministic yet unpredictable systems, influencing various disciplines, including meteorology and physics.

14. **Advancements in Number Theory (20th century):** Significant progress was made in number theory, particularly through the works of mathematicians like Andrew Wiles, who proved Fermat's Last Theorem, and the development of algebraic number theory.

15. **Applied Mathematics (20th century onwards):** Mathematics found applications in diverse fields such as economics, biology, and engineering. Game theory, developed by John Nash, became crucial in understanding strategic decision-making.

16. **String Theory and Advanced Mathematical Physics (20th century onwards):** The intersection of mathematics and theoretical physics deepened with the development of string theory. Concepts from advanced mathematics, including algebraic geometry and topology, played a pivotal role in this interdisciplinary field.

17. **Mathematics in the Digital Age (21st century):** The 21st century witnesses an increased focus on data science, machine learning, and artificial intelligence, with mathematics serving as the backbone for these technologies. Cryptography, optimization algorithms, and big data analytics have become integral parts of contemporary mathematical research.

18. **Unsolved Problems and New Frontiers:** Several prominent mathematical problems, like the Riemann Hypothesis and the Birch and Switzerland Conjecture, continue to challenge mathematicians. Exploration of new frontiers, such as homotopy type theory in theoretical computer science, showcases the ongoing vitality and openness of mathematical inquiry.

The history of mathematics is a dynamic narrative, continually evolving as mathematicians explore new ideas and deepen our understanding of the fundamental structures underlying the universe. The pursuit of mathematical knowledge remains an ever-unfolding journey.
